New executive appointments at ANZ

(21 September 2012 – Australia) ANZ has announced three senior appointments reporting directly to chief executive Philip Chronican. Matthew Boss has been appointed managing director Products & Marketing. Boss joins ANZ from Bank of America based in North Carolina where he has held senior retail banking roles across finance, product management and consumer segments. He will commence with ANZ at the end of October 2012.

Glenn Haslam has been appointed general manager Transformation. In this new role Haslam will be responsible for bringing together Australia’s transformation priorities to simplify its business, drive productivity improvements and make it easier for customers to bank with ANZ. He is currently acting managing director, Product & Marketing.

Jeremy Dean has been appointed general manager Australia Operations. Dean is currently general manager Business Execution for Corporate and Commercial Australia having joined ANZ three years ago.

Chronican said the appointments strengthen the bank’s Australian leadership team and provide focus on ANZ’s plans to reshape the way it meets the changing needs of consumer and business customers.
